MINSK, Apr 6 – PrimePress. Russian Railways has introduced an up to 33.5% discount to tariff on crude exports to Belarus, the company said in its telegram channel on Tuesday.
“The executive team of Russian Railways has decided to set discounts in the framework of a tariff corridor on crude exports in cisterns from several stations of the South Urals railway towards stations Barbarov and Novopolotsk of Belarusian railway in case of transit across Russian border stations Zlynka and Rudnya,” the company said.
The discounts would amount to 26.3% for transportation from Sorochinskaya and 33.5% from Buzuluk, Kargala, Orenburg, Krasnogvardeyets. End
